Gov. Crist May Call Session on Auto

The Ledger - TALLAHASSEE - Gov. Charlie Crist said Wednesday he was "pretty close" to calling a special legislative session to seek renewal of the state's no-fault automobile insurance system, which is set to expire Oct. 1. Insurance companies have been pushing ...
